Condition Rating
Fair

The property, built in 1924, is well-maintained but shows significant signs of being outdated. While the kitchen has modern appliances, the cabinets, countertops, and flooring are dated. The bathrooms, especially the primary one, feature very old-fashioned colored fixtures and tile work, suggesting the last major renovation occurred 15-30 years ago. Other elements like popcorn ceilings, traditional light fixtures, and a mirrored wall also contribute to an aged aesthetic. The home is functional but requires substantial cosmetic updates to meet current standards.
